About Rigetti Computing Stock (NASDAQ:RGTI)

Rigetti Computing, Inc., through its subsidiaries, builds quantum computers and the superconducting quantum processors. The company offers cloud in a form of quantum processing unit, such as 9-qubit chip and Ankaa-2 system under the Novera brand name; and sells access to its quantum computers through quantum computing as a service. It also provides quantum cloud services that provides various range of support in programming, public or private clouds integration, and connectivity, as well as quantum operating system software that supports both public and private cloud architectures. In addition, the company offers professional services, such as algorithm development, benchmarking, quantum application programming, and software development. The company serves commercial enterprises, government organizations, and international government entities. It has operations in the United States and the United Kingdom. Rigetti Computing, Inc. was founded in 2013 and is headquartered in Berkeley, California.

Are investors shorting Rigetti Computing?

Rigetti Computing saw a increase in short interest in March. As of March 31st, there was short interest totaling 16,790,000 shares, an increase of 23.9% from the March 15th total of 13,550,000 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 6,850,000 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 2.5 days. Approximately 15.8% of the shares of the stock are sold short.

How were Rigetti Computing's earnings last quarter?

Rigetti Computing, Inc. (NASDAQ:RGTI) pos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, March, 14th. The company reported ($0.09) EPS for the quarter. The business earned $3.38 million during the quarter. Rigetti Computing had a negative trailing twelve-month return on equity of 59.51% and a negative net margin of 625.42%.
